Actually the frame in the kickup area in the rear wheelhouse has just another piece of the same frame welded in over the top. Kind of a butcher method but I guess there wasn't a real body man involved. It worked but it is a source of rust between these two pieces. I have two of these trucks. A 94 with a flat tappet cam and a 95 with a roller. the 94 is black and the 95 is white. Looking for a red 93.
